Output 13407119469e72923047ab2c5630863066fa2956b8923c8a507e487495c7fb88:0

value
5986976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 753882beac6a101096798abdad64c399eb67ebaa OP_EQUAL
address
3CNpgRQt6f4esZ6pfFBEbJG6w1pGUWnckC
transaction
13407119469e72923047ab2c5630863066fa2956b8923c8a507e487495c7fb88
spent
true